I think it works in the US because those airlines are often going head to head on the same routes, giving the customer a choice between which to use.
In South America, there is very little competition on most routes. Latam dominates obviously, but hardly even tries to compete on some other quite major routes. eg. Sao Paulo - Buenoes Aires (2 flights per day), Rio de Janeiro - Buenos Aires (1 flight per day). Latam has basically just given these routes to Aerolineas Argentinas & Gol. So if that is your most regular flight, then Latam is not the airline you want status with.
But Latam dominates the continent for most destinations & you don't really have the "choice" of using another alliance. Whilst you can find a different airline on many routes, you can't find a different airline that is the same alliance for most. eg. The two biggest competitors to Latam are Gol & Azul, both of whom are Brazilian based & focused & not a part of any alliance. Avianca is OK if you're Colombia based but if you want to fly anywhere other than the major city in Chile, Argentina, Peru, Brazil (SAO + Rio)etc, you'll need to fly or connect with someone else.
So my point is, Latam don't need to offer someone a "challenge". Either the person is flying in South America (in which case they will have one Latam flight) & they will status match them, or they're not flying in South America & they won't. The number who ARE flying in South America that don't have a single Latam flight would be very small I guess.
